NET Power (NYSE:NPWR) Shares Down 5.1% After Analyst Downgrade

NET Power Inc. (NYSE:NPWR – Get Free Report) shares traded down 5.1% during trading on Wednesday after Barclays lowered their price target on the stock from $11.00 to $3.00. Barclays currently has an equal weight rating on the stock. NET Power traded as low as $2.87 and last traded at $3.06. 547,307 shares traded hands […]

Mar 14, 2025 - 07:35
 0
NET Power (NYSE:NPWR)  Shares Down 5.1%  After Analyst Downgrade
NET Power Inc. (NYSE:NPWR – Get Free Report) shares traded down 5.1% during trading on Wednesday after Barclays lowered their price target on the stock from $11.00 to $3.00. Barclays currently has an equal weight rating on the stock. NET Power traded as low as $2.87 and last traded at $3.06. 547,307 shares traded hands […]